Model Deployment
Fine-tuned **Gemma-2-9B** running via 4-bit quantization. Optimized for local inferencing on NVIDIA L4/A100 clusters to ensure <200ms latency per transaction audit.
Data Sovereignty Protocol
Zero-Knowledge Architecture. Transaction metadata is processed in volatile memory (RAM) and purged immediately after the forensic trace is generated. No data persistence on cloud disks.
Compliance Engine
Built-in mapping for **RBI Cyber Security Framework (CSF)**. Ocularis automatically flags patterns consistent with Smurfing, Mule-Account clustering, and Synthetic Identity Fraud.
